The median sold price in Chessington Hill Park is £249,950, based on 104 sales recorded by HM Land Registry.
Over the past decade prices in Chessington Hill Park are +48% in cash terms, and +3% after adjusting for inflation (ONS CPIH).
The median is £3,378 per square metre, from EPC floor-area records.
Figures update monthly from HM Land Registry. The most recent sale here was recorded on 30 August 2024; the latest two months may be incomplete while sales register.
